我有两张桌子。我想根据 table2 中的相同行索引更新 table1 中的一行。ID 不匹配,但表 2 中的 ID 与行索引匹配。表 2 中总会有更多数据,但我不在乎是否遗漏了额外的行。
我将如何在 mysql UPDATE 语句中实现这一点?
table 1 ______________ table 2 _____________
Row number | id | value | Row number | id | value |
|--------------| |-----|-------|
1 | 2 | A | 1 | 1 | W |
2 | 4 | B | 2 | 2 | X |
3 | 6 | C | 3 | 3 | Y |
4 | 4 | Z |
to:
table 1 ______________
Row number | id | value |
|--------------|
1 | 2 | W |
2 | 4 | X |
3 | 6 | Y |